Comprehending the Mechanisms Behind Car Locks
Before diving into opening methods, it's essential to comprehend how car locks function. Modern cars typically employ advanced locking systems that enhance security. These consist of:
Traditional Key Locks: Found in older models, these locks need a physical key.Transponder Keys: These keys contain a chip that communicates with the vehicle's ignition, preventing unapproved access.Remote Keyless Entry: These systems make use of a key fob to lock and unlock the vehicle from a range.Smart Keys: A newer technology that permits gain access to without needing to physically use a key.

When confronted with a car lockout circumstance, alternatives for unlocking your vehicle differ in efficiency and safety. Here are a couple of common techniques:
1. Using a Spare Key
If you have an extra key, this is the most efficient method to unlock your vehicle. Numerous options for spare keys include:
Hidden Spare Key: Securing an extra type in a magnetic case in a discrete location on your vehicle.Buddies or Family: Keeping a spare key with someone you rely on in your area.2. Calling Roadside Assistance
Numerous automobile insurance plan and road assistance programs offer services to unlock your vehicle. This alternative is especially beneficial if you belong to a service like AAA or have coverage through your car producer.
3. Using a Slim Jim
A slim jim is a thin strip of metal that can be inserted in between the window and weather condition stripping to unlock the door mechanism. This method requires ability, as it can harm the vehicle if not executed correctly. Car owners ought to seek advice from an expert locksmith for this method.

Prevention Tips to Avoid Lockouts
The best way to deal with lockouts is to avoid them from taking place in the first place. Here are some reliable ideas:
